    Vulcan Combi Ovens: The Productivity Powerhouse

    November means more complex menu items and higher volume demands. Traditional cooking methods simply can’t keep pace. Vulcan combi ovens revolutionize kitchen operations with their three-in-one capability. These workhorses combine steaming, roasting, and baking in a single footprint. You can prepare proteins, vegetables, and baked goods simultaneously in different chambers. Consequently, cook times drop by up to 40% compared to conventional methods.

    The Vulcan ABC7E combi oven features programmable cooking modes. These modes ensure consistency every single time. Your kitchen staff can save favorite recipes with precise temperature settings. They can also control humidity levels perfectly. Furthermore, these units reduce labor requirements significantly. One operator can manage multiple cooking processes from a single control panel. The intuitive touchscreen interface makes training new hires faster and easier.

    Therefore, your experienced team can focus on plating and guest interaction. They no longer need to monitor multiple pieces of equipment constantly. Vulcan’s energy-efficient design also addresses rising utility costs in South Florida. The ovens use up to 60% less energy than traditional equipment. Their insulated construction retains heat better even in warm climates. As a result, this translates to lower gas or electric bills every month.

    True Reach-In Refrigeration: Built for High-Volume Performance

    Busier dining rooms require smarter cold storage solutions for South Florida’s climate. True Manufacturing has been the industry leader in commercial refrigeration for over 75 years. Their reach-in units deliver the reliability restaurants need during peak season. True’s T-Series reach-in refrigerators feature oversized, factory-balanced refrigeration systems. These units maintain consistent temperatures even when doors open frequently during service.

    The True T-72 three-door reach-in provides 72 cubic feet of accessible storage. Your line cooks can grab ingredients without leaving their stations. Consequently, ticket times decrease and kitchen flow improves dramatically. The unit’s stainless steel interior and exterior resist corrosion from coastal humidity. Heavy-duty shelving supports up to 300 pounds per shelf. In addition, LED interior lighting makes finding items quick and easy.

    Moreover, True’s hydrocarbon refrigerants meet environmental standards while delivering superior cooling. The brand’s commitment to sustainability doesn’t compromise performance. Their units consistently maintain temperatures within 2 degrees of setpoint. This precision preserves ingredient quality throughout your busiest shifts. Your produce stays crisp despite Florida’s heat. Proteins remain at food-safe temperatures. Additionally, True’s self-closing doors feature a stay-open option. This improves both efficiency and food safety.

    Hatco Holding Equipment: Where Quality Meets Consistency

    November guests expect perfection on every visit to Fort Lauderdale restaurants. Hatco Corporation has specialized in foodservice holding equipment since 1950. Their products ensure your food stays at ideal serving temperature. They accomplish this without overcooking or drying out the food. Hatco Glo-Ray heated shelves use infrared technology to maintain food quality during service rushes. These units keep plated entrees at 140°F or higher. Importantly, they do this without continuing to cook the product.

    The Hatco GRPWS-4824D heated shelf features dual ceramic infrared elements. This design provides even heat distribution across the entire surface. You can hold multiple plates simultaneously without hot or cold spots. Meanwhile, Hatco’s drawer warmers excel at keeping sides, appetizers, and bread service items ready. The HDW-2BN built-in drawer warmer fits seamlessly into existing serving stations.

    Hatco heated display cases do double duty for operations with grab-and-go or buffet service. The GRHD-3PD curved glass display showcases food while maintaining proper temperatures. This increases impulse purchases and average check sizes. Furthermore, Hatco equipment prevents food waste from over-holding. Your kitchen can batch-cook popular items confidently. Dishes stay fresh for extended periods. As a result, this reduces pressure during peak service windows.
